                                                    </description><item><title>The Philippines - Earthquake - update (NDRRMC, PHIVOLCS, OCHA, DG ECHO) (ECHO Daily Flash of 02 August 2022)</title><link>https://reliefweb.int/report/philippines/philippines-earthquake-update-ndrrmc-phivolcs-ocha-dg-echo-echo-daily-flash-02-august-2022</link><description>Following the 7.0 magnitude earthquake that struck Abra Province in the Northern Philippines on 27 July 2022, the number of people in need continues to increase. On 2 August 2022, the National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Council (NDRRMC) reported 404,370 affected people.</description><pubDate>2022-08-02T12:53+0200</pubDate><guid>reliefWeb-50f5c6bafa935241b59ed71f50dd466a</guid><sortelement xmlns="emm">20220802125300</sortelement></item><item><title>Humanitarian Community in the Philippines scales up support to the Government in Abra response</title><link>https://reliefweb.int/report/philippines/humanitarian-community-philippines-scales-support-government-abra-response</link><description>MANILA, 2 August 2022 The United Nations (UN) in the Philippines has arranged a satellite image assessment on the impact of the recent 7.0-magnitud earthquake to support the work of the Philippines Office of Civil Defense (OCD). “ TheUN Office for the Coordination of Humanitarian Affairs (OCHA) is....</description><pubDate>2022-08-02T12:17+0200</pubDate><guid>reliefWeb-8de9e3319c5d1a31f1cd3e729361f1ff</guid><sortelement xmlns="emm">20220802121700</sortelement></item><item><title>Si possono prevedere i terremoti?
